Ingredients
- 1.5 lbs, cubed Chuck roast
- 2 cups Low-sodium beef bone broth
- 1 cup Beef broth
- 2 medium, chopped Carrots
- 2 stalks, chopped Celery
- 1, diced Onion
- 4 cloves, minced Garlic
- 1 tsp, dried Thyme
- 1/2 tsp, dried Rosemary
- 1 tbsp Olive oil
- 1 tbsp Arrowroot powder
- 2 tbsp Water
Instructions
- Step 1: Season cubed chuck roast with salt and pepper, then heat 1 tbsp ol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Sear beef in batches for 2 minutes per side until deeply browned, then transfer to a slow cooker.
- Step 2: Add diced onion, celery, carrots, and minced garlic to the skillet. Cook for 3 minutes until softened, then stir in dried thyme and rosemary. Pour in beef bone broth and beef broth, scraping up any browned bits, and simmer for 2 minutes. Pour mixture over the beef in the slow cooker.
- Step 3: Cover and cook on low for 8 hours until beef is fork-tender. Remove beef from slow cooker and set aside. In a small bowl, mix arrowroot powder with 2 tbsp water to make a slurry. Stir slurry into the hot liquid in the slow cooker and cook on high for 15 minutes until sauce thickens and coats the back of a spoon. Return beef to the pot, stir to coat, and serve with extra thyme.

How do I store leftover Crockpot Beef & Bone Broth Stew with Root Vegetables?
Cool to room temperature within 2 hours, then store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days. Reheat covered in a 350°F oven for 10-12 minutes, or microwave at 70% power in 60-second bursts to keep cubed chuck roast from drying out.

How do I scale Crockpot Beef & Bone Broth Stew with Root Vegetables for a different number of people?
The recipe is written for 4 servings. Multiply each ingredient by (your serving target / 4). Cook time stays roughly the same up to 2x; for 3-4x batches, switch from a skillet to a sheet pan or stockpot so the food isn't crowded — overcrowding steams instead of browns.
